    I'm looking to buy my first home cinema set. It's for a small bedroom and there's not a whole lot of space. I've decided on the Yamaha VX373 receiver and I'm thinking maybe 2 Cambridge Minx11's with it. Will that work or will I also need a sub? Would the Cambridge S80 suit?

    The MIN11's are brilliant but are really too small to give you any effective audio quality without a subwoofer..the Cambridge Audio S80 will work great but the correct matching sub is actually the Minx x200 at £249.95
